Foreign exchange reserves excluding gold rose 10.5% to USD 76.3 bil in Peru in 2024, according to the National Statistical Office.

Historically, foreign exchange reserves excluding gold in Peru reached an all time high of USD 76.6 bil in 2021 and an all time low of USD 0.034 bil in 1960. When compared to Peru's main peers, foreign exchange reserves excluding gold in Bolivia amounted to USD 0.087 bil, USD 319 bil in Brazil, USD 44.4 bil in Chile and USD 61.5 bil in Colombia in 2024.

Peru has been ranked 31st within the group of 125 countries we follow in terms of foreign exchange reserves excluding gold, 2 places below the position seen 10 years ago.
